South Carolina’s First Veterinary School Takes Shape at Clemson

South Carolina’s First Veterinary School Takes Shape at Clemson

by Editor | Jun 1, 2025 | News, Students, Veterinary Practice

Source: Insight into Academia Clemson University has broken ground on the Harvey S. Peeler Jr. College of Veterinary Medicine (CVM), marking South Carolina’s first Veterinary school and aiming to combat a critical shortage of veterinarians, especially in rural areas....
